The Magic Behind Ozempic: Singapore’s New Ally in the Fight Against Type 2 Diabetes

Type 2 diabetes management has been revolutionized with the introduction of Ozempic, a prescription medication that has gained significant attention in Singapore. Its active ingredient, semaglutide, belongs to a class of drugs known as gl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) agonists.

The Mechanism: Balancing Blood Sugar and Body Weight

Ozempic exerts its effect by mimicking the function of GLP-1, a hormone in the body that lowers blood sugar post meals by stimulating insulin release. It also decreases the release of glucagon, a hormone that raises blood sugar. Importantly, Ozempic also reduces food intake by slowing gastric emptying and decreasing appetite.

Weight Loss: A Welcome Side Effect

As a weight loss medication, Ozempic assists in reducing body weight. It can promote weight loss by decreasing appetite and slowing gastric emptying, leading to reduced food intake. Clinical trials have shown patients on Ozempic lose weight consistently, contributing to better weight management.

Ozempic and Cardiovascular Events: An Overview

In addition to improving blood sugar control and promoting weight loss, Ozempic has shown potential benefits in reducing major cardiovascular events such as heart attacks in adults with type 2 diabetes, especially those with known heart disease.

The Administration of Semaglutide Injection

Semaglutide injection is administered under the skin of the abdomen, thigh, or upper arm. Any discomfort at the injection site usually subsides over time.

Navigating the Side Effects

The most common side effects of Ozempic include minor gastrointestinal disturbances, but more serious allergic reactions can occur. It’s crucial to talk to your healthcare provider about any concerns, especially if you have a person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or thyroid tumors.

Missing a Dose and Other Considerations

In the event of a missed dose, it’s recommended to take the next dose as soon as you remember. However, if it’s near the time for the next d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ular schedule.
